Factors to Consider When Choosing Multi-tool Cordless Drills

Choosing the right multi-tool cordless drill involves understanding several key factors beyond just specs. Consider how much power you need—lighter tasks require less torque, but demanding projects benefit from higher motor ratings. Battery compatibility is crucial if you already own tools from specific brands, saving you money and space. Accessory variety can significantly influence the tool’s usefulness; a wide selection means fewer limitations. Don’t overlook weight and ergonomics, especially if you’ll be using the drill for extended periods. Lastly, evaluate the overall value, including warranty coverage and customer support, to ensure long-term satisfaction.

Power and Performance

Power ratings, typically measured in volts and torque, directly affect how well a multi-tool drill can handle different materials. Higher voltage usually translates to more raw power, suitable for tougher tasks like demolition or thick wood. However, increased power often means added weight, which can cause fatigue during prolonged use. Balance your needs by considering the scope of your projects—light DIY jobs may not require the highest power levels, but professionals will benefit from more robust motors.

Battery Compatibility and Runtime

Since many multi-tool drills are part of larger product ecosystems, compatibility with existing batteries can be a cost-saving feature. Larger batteries extend runtime but add weight, which can affect handling. Fast-charging options are also worth considering to minimize downtime. For frequent users or those working on big projects, investing in higher-capacity batteries or those with quick-charge features can make a noticeable difference in productivity.

Accessory and Tool Compatibility

The versatility of a multi-tool drill hinges on its accessory ecosystem. Look for models that support a wide range of attachments, from sanding pads to cutting blades. Some tools come with comprehensive accessory kits, which provide immediate value. Keep in mind that not all accessories are compatible across brands, so check for standard fittings or universal adapters if you plan to expand your toolkit over time.

Ergonomics and Weight

Comfort during extended use depends heavily on the tool’s weight and grip design. Lighter models reduce fatigue but may sacrifice some power or durability. Ergonomic handles and balanced weight distribution can improve control and reduce strain. If you anticipate long sessions or overhead work, prioritize models with comfortable grips and manageable weight, even if it means paying a bit more.

Price and Overall Value

Pricing varies widely in this category, often reflecting the scope of features, build quality, and brand reputation. A higher price tag typically indicates better durability and more features, but affordable options can be perfectly adequate for casual use. Evaluate what each package offers—such as batteries, accessories, and warranties—and match it to your budget and project needs. Remember, investing a little more upfront can pay off through increased longevity and performance.

Frequently Asked Questions

Can I use the same batteries across different brands?

Using batteries across brands depends on compatibility; some brands design their batteries to be proprietary, making cross-brand use impossible or risky. However, a few third-party adapters exist, allowing some interchangeability, but these can affect warranty and safety. If you already own tools from a specific brand, choosing a multi-tool drill within that system can save money and ensure compatibility. Always verify compatibility before purchasing to avoid frustration or potential damage.

Are multi-tool cordless drills suitable for heavy-duty demolition work?

Most multi-tool cordless drills are designed for versatility rather than extreme demolition. While some high-voltage models with robust motors can handle tougher tasks, dedicated demolition tools or rotary hammers are more appropriate for heavy-duty tearing down walls or breaking concrete. Multi-tools excel in cutting, sanding, and light demolition, but for serious destruction, investing in specialized equipment is advisable to ensure safety and efficiency.

How important is accessory variety for my everyday projects?

Accessory variety significantly enhances a multi-tool drill’s usefulness, especially for varied tasks like sanding, cutting, or grinding. A broad selection allows you to switch functions quickly without needing multiple tools, saving space and money. For those who frequently work on different materials or projects, a kit with numerous attachments can streamline workflow. However, if your tasks are limited to basic drilling or screwing, a more streamlined model with fewer accessories might suffice.

Should I prioritize battery life or power for my projects?

The best choice depends on your typical workload. Longer battery life means less downtime, which is advantageous for extended jobs or remote work sites. On the other hand, higher power ratings enable the tool to handle tougher materials more effectively. For most users, a balanced approach—good battery life combined with sufficient power—is ideal. Investing in higher-capacity batteries or models with fast-charging features can help maintain both power and runtime for demanding projects.

Is it worth paying more for a professional-grade multi-tool drill?

Paying more typically grants benefits like increased durability, more powerful motors, and advanced features such as variable speed control or better ergonomics. If you rely heavily on your tools for daily or demanding work, investing in a professional-grade model can improve efficiency and longevity. However, for occasional or light use, a mid-range or budget option may provide all necessary functionality without the extra cost. Assess your workload and durability needs before deciding.
